#b921c4 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b921c4 is composed of 72.5% red, 12.9%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.6% cyan, 83.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 296 degrees, a saturation of 71.2% and a lightness of 44.9%. #b921c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ff42ff with #730089.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

● #b921c4 color description : Strong magenta.
The hexadecimal color #b921c4 has RGB values of R:185, G:33,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0.83,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12132804.
